How can the relative positions of an aquifer and aquiclude result in the presence of a spring?

Springs occur naturally and are found where an aquifer and an aquiclude intersect the surface. Or where a confining layer is broken and water rises to the surface by itself. “Artesian Spring”
 
A well is a pipe inserted by people. Using a pump, water is drawn to the surface. In the case of an Artesian Well, the water rises into the pipe by itself from a confined aquifer.
